You've seen it featured at the Maker's Faire in San Mateo and Austin,
marveled at its complicated beauty at Ace Drunkyard and the Haunted
Barn in San Francisco, and stared at it for hours (high on mushrooms
probably) out at the Burning Man festival in Nevada ... but you never
knew just how much elbow grease and chump change it takes the
LIFE-SIZE MOUSETRAP's cranky clown-gineers to keep the cockamamie
contraption in peak condition.

After four years of getting tossed around in the back of a semi
trailer, the Life-Sized version of the classic Rube Goldberg-esque
children's board game has come home to San Francisco, and it?s badly
in need of some maintenance. Gears must be re-geared, paint jobs must
be re-painted; tours must be embarked upon; sexy mice must be kept
safe from the evil cat ... and that enormous pumpkin / pile of
bicycles / birthday cake / junked car isn't going to smash itself, so
the handmade crane needs to be shored up to make sure the two-ton safe
can still do it ... uh, safely.
